Gas extinguishing is a proven technique to automatically protect computer rooms (data centres).

An effective gas extinguishing system requires the installation of products whose reliability is certified by BOSEC, a voluntary seal of approval that attests to their quality.

We conduct tests on gas extinguishing components so that they can be BOSEC certified in accordance with the standards and specifications below.

Our tests also guarantee minimum legal requirements for the release of products in accordance with European construction product regulations (CE-CPR).

  • NBN EN 12094-1 Fixed firefighting systems - Components for gas extinguishing systems - Part 1: Requirements and test methods for electrical automatic control and delay devices
  • NBN EN 12094-3 Fixed firefighting systems - Components for gas extinguishing systems - Part 3: Requirements and test methods for manual triggering and stop devices
  • NBN EN 12094-4 Fixed firefighting systems - Components for gas extinguishing systems - Part 4: Requirements and test methods for container valve assemblies and their actuators
  • NBN EN 12094-6 Fixed firefighting systems - Components for gas extinguishing systems - Part 6: Requirements and test methods for non-electrical disable devices
  • NTN 12094-1 Fixed firefighting systems – Components for gas extinguishing systems – Requirements and test methods for electrical automatic control and delay devices
